Square Enix confirms a spring release for the sequel to Chris Taylor's critically acclaimed Supreme Commander...

Sqaure Enix has announced that the long-awaited sequel to 2007's Supreme Commander will be available next spring, when the series will return its PC spawning grounds while launching simultaneously on the Xbox 360.

Set 25 years after the events of the original Supreme Commander's Infinite War, Supreme Commander 2 kicks-off after the President of the Colonial Defense Coalition is assassinated, which brings the United Earth Federation, Cyber Nation, and The Illuminate factions into direct conflict.

"The partnership with Square Enix has been a highlight of my career," said Chris Taylor, Founder and Creative Director of Gas Powered Games. "I couldn't be more proud of what the team has accomplished, as the game has continually exceeded all of my expectations throughout its development."

Ever since Total Annihilation, Chris Taylor's RTS calling card has been his Strategic Zoom interface, which allows gamers to pan out of battle to stratospheric heights and organise units from a macro perspective. Fans of Taylor's work will be happy to know that the interface will return in Supreme Commander 2 alongside a wide range of customisable units.
